What does DISCREDIT mean?

  1. noun

    the state of being held in low esteem

    “your actions will bring discredit to your name”

  2. verb

    cause to be distrusted or disbelieved

    “The paper discredited the politician with its nasty commentary”

  3. verb

    damage the reputation of

    “This newspaper story discredits the politicians”

  4. verb

    reject as false; refuse to accept

Definitions from WordNet 3.1, Princeton University.
